Overview
The DPC816W-A-TU-V is a single-channel transistor output optocoupler manufactured by Diodes Incorporated. It features an NPN phototransistor output and is housed in a 4-pin MDIP package for through-hole mounting. The device provides 5000 Vrms insulation voltage and supports a maximum collector-emitter voltage of 80 V with a collector current of 30 mA. Key electrical parameters include a forward current of 5 mA, forward voltage of 1.25 V, and saturation voltage of 200 mV. Current transfer ratio ranges from 80% to 160%, with rise and fall times of 18 µs. Operating temperature spans -55°C to +110°C.

Selection Notes
Select this component when high isolation voltage is required alongside moderate speed switching capabilities. The NPN output configuration suits applications needing active-low signaling or pull-up resistor interfaces. Consider the 18 µs propagation delay for timing-sensitive designs. Evaluate the 80 V collector voltage headroom against load requirements to ensure safe operation margins under transient conditions.
